The first step in decorating a soundtrack for a couple is identifying the musical intersections where your tastes meet. It is rarely about having identical musical tastes, but rather finding the harmony in differences. Start by exploring the songs that define your early memories together: the concert you attended on your third date, the track that was playing on your first road trip, or the song that immediately reminds you of one another. This foundational layer should feel nostalgic and intimately connected to the relationship’s history. Discussing “your songs” helps define the tone of the soundtrack, creating a shared audio narrative that reflects your unique bond. Curating for Moments: Atmosphere and Mood

A great soundtrack is contextual. To “decorate” a space with sound, you must curate playlists for specific moods or activities. A romantic dinner at home requires a vastly different soundscape than a lively Sunday morning cooking session or a relaxing, acoustic-driven evening by the fire. Curate a “Slow Burn” playlist featuring soft indie-folk or jazz for intimate moments, and a “High Energy” playlist for upbeat adventures. Consider creating a “Nostalgia” playlist that brings back the thrill of early dating, or a “Chill” playlist for winding down after a long day. The goal is to match the music to the activity, allowing sound to enhance the emotional atmosphere of the moment.

The Art of Personalization: Curated Playlists and Crossovers

Take curation a step further by blending your individual musical worlds. Dedicate time to sharing your favorite songs with your partner, explaining why they matter to you, and listening to their favorites in return. This exchange fosters deeper understanding and creates a more eclectic, personal soundscape. Create “crossover” playlists where your favorite high-energy pop seamlessly blends with their love for classic rock. Introducing your partner to new genres or artists is a form of sharing your world with them, enriching the shared soundtrack with personal history and emotional depth.
